You may obtain a copy of the License at * * http://www.apache.org/licenses/LICENSE-2.0 * * Unless required by applicable law or agreed to in writing, software * distributed under the License is distributed on an "AS IS" BASIS, * WITHOUT WARRANTIES OR CONDITIONS OF ANY KIND, either express or implied. * See the License for the specific language governing permissions and * limitations under the License. */ package com.sun.org.apache.xerces.internal.dom; import java.util.ArrayList; import java.util.List; import java.util.StringTokenizer; import org.w3c.dom.DOMImplementation; import org.w3c.dom.DOMImplementationList; import org.w3c.dom.DOMImplementationSource; /** * Supply one the right implementation, based upon requested features. Each * implemented DOMImplementationSource object is listed in the * binding-specific list of available sources so that its * DOMImplementation objects are made available. * *

See also the * * Document Object Model (DOM) Level 3 Core Specification. * * @xerces.internal * * @LastModified: Oct 2017 */ public class DOMImplementationSourceImpl implements DOMImplementationSource { /** * A method to request a DOM implementation. * @param features A string that specifies which features are required. * This is a space separated list in which each feature is specified * by its name optionally followed by a space and a version number. * This is something like: "XML 1.0 Traversal Events 2.0" * @return An implementation that has the desired features, or * null if this source has none. */ public DOMImplementation getDOMImplementation(String features) { // first check whether the CoreDOMImplementation would do DOMImplementation impl = CoreDOMImplementationImpl.getDOMImplementation(); if (testImpl(impl, features)) { return impl; } // if not try the DOMImplementation impl = DOMImplementationImpl.getDOMImplementation(); if (testImpl(impl, features)) { return impl; } return null; } /** * A method to request a list of DOM implementations that support the * specified features and versions, as specified in . * @param features A string that specifies which features and versions * are required. This is a space separated list in which each feature * is specified by its name optionally followed by a space and a * version number. This is something like: "XML 3.0 Traversal +Events * 2.0" * @return A list of DOM implementations that support the desired * features. */ public DOMImplementationList getDOMImplementationList(String features) { // first check whether the CoreDOMImplementation would do DOMImplementation impl = CoreDOMImplementationImpl.getDOMImplementation(); final List implementations = new ArrayList<>(); if (testImpl(impl, features)) { implementations.add(impl); } impl = DOMImplementationImpl.getDOMImplementation(); if (testImpl(impl, features)) { implementations.add(impl); } return new DOMImplementationListImpl(implementations); } boolean testImpl(DOMImplementation impl, String features) { StringTokenizer st = new StringTokenizer(features); String feature = null; String version = null; if (st.hasMoreTokens()) { feature = st.nextToken(); } while (feature != null) { boolean isVersion = false; if (st.hasMoreTokens()) { char c; version = st.nextToken(); c = version.charAt(0); switch (c) { case '0': case '1': case '2': case '3': case '4': case '5': case '6': case '7': case '8': case '9': isVersion = true; } } else { version = null; } if (isVersion) { if (!impl.hasFeature(feature, version)) { return false; } if (st.hasMoreTokens()) { feature = st.nextToken(); } else { feature = null; } } else { if (!impl.hasFeature(feature, null)) { return false; } feature = version; } } return true; } }
